C語言是一門非常常用的編程語言,它的應(yīng)用范圍非常廣泛。其中C語言的JSON轉(zhuǎn)義字符也是非常重要的一部分。JSON對(duì)象是一種用于數(shù)據(jù)交換的標(biāo)準(zhǔn)文件格式,當(dāng)我們將JSON對(duì)象轉(zhuǎn)化為字符串時(shí),我們需要注意JSON的轉(zhuǎn)義字符。以下是一些C語言常用的JSON轉(zhuǎn)移字符:
JSON 轉(zhuǎn)義符號(hào) 意義 \\\\ 反斜線 \\\" 雙引號(hào) \\\/ 斜線 \\b 退格鍵 \\f 換頁 \\n 換行 \\r 回車 \\t 水平制表符
因?yàn)镴SON格式中必須使用雙引號(hào)來定義字符串,所以如果在字符串中使用雙引號(hào),我們應(yīng)當(dāng)使用轉(zhuǎn)義字符\\\"來表示。類似地,如果我們需要在字符串中使用反斜線,我們應(yīng)該使用雙反斜杠\\\\來代替。
在使用JSON轉(zhuǎn)義字符時(shí),我們必須注意C語言中的轉(zhuǎn)義字符和JSON中的轉(zhuǎn)義字符有所不同。例如在JSON中,\\b表示退格鍵,但在C語言中,\\b表示的是空格。因此,在C語言中使用JSON轉(zhuǎn)義字符時(shí),我們應(yīng)該根據(jù)實(shí)際情況進(jìn)行區(qū)分。
總之,JSON轉(zhuǎn)義字符是C語言中非常重要的一部分,我們應(yīng)該仔細(xì)地了解這些轉(zhuǎn)義字符的用途和正確的使用方法,以確保我們能夠成功地將JSON對(duì)象轉(zhuǎn)化為字符串。